Question

At an interface between two dielectrics, which component of field is continuous?
  1. A
    Normal component of E
  2. B
    Tangential component of E
    Correct
  3. C
    Normal component of D
  4. D
    All components

Correct answer

Tangential component of E

Explanation

Boundary conditions: E_tangential is continuous (from ∮E·dl = 0). D_normal is continuous if no surface free charge. E_normal is discontinuous (D_n continuous + different ε_r).
